Driver Support and Software:
The main factor that determines Mac system compatibility is the availability of driver software and other necessary programs. Logitech provides dedicated software for customizing and configuring its gaming mouse, including the Logitech Gaming Software (LGS) and Logitech G HUB. Logitech developed software for Mac operating systems through most of its history until it created better Windows-based software. Logitech established better Mac support through development efforts which included creating features that operate similarly on both operating systems.
Logitech Gaming Software (LGS) The Logitech Gaming Software (LGS) is a legacy software application that provides customization options for Logitech gaming peripherals, including the G703 mouse. The Mac version of LGS contains restricted features which results in a partial functionality reduction compared to the Windows version. Users should visit Logitech’s website to obtain the most recent LGS version that works with their particular Mac operating system.
Logitech G HUB:
Logitech G HUB functions as the successor to LGS which provides users with a new design and additional options for personalizing their Logitech gaming equipment. G HUB provides users with complete control over their devices, which enables them to customize button functions and modify DPI settings and RGB lights plus additional features. The G HUB application functions on both Windows and Mac systems, but users will experience different features and performance levels between the two operating systems.

Native macOS Support:
The Logitech G703 mouse functions as a plug-and-play device on macOS because users can operate the device without installing any drivers or additional software. Basic functionality such as cursor movement, left and right clicks, and scrolling should function seamlessly on Mac systems without the need for configuration. Users who want to use advanced customization options for their devices will not have access to these features which Logitech software utilities provide.
